Village style nattu kozhi biryani recipe

Share this =>

Nattu kozhi biryani will taste better than when you make it with broiler chicken. Naturally raised nattu kozhi is good for health and when you make biryani its the ultimate dish.

INGREDIENTS:

  1. County Chicken pieces - 1 kilogram
  2. Seeraga Samba rice - 1 kilogram
  3. Sliced onion - 1/4 kilogram
  4. Chopped Shallot (sambar onion) - 1 handful
  5. Chopped tomato - 3
  6. Slit green chili - 8
  7. Chopped Mint leaf - from 1 small bunch
  8. Chopped Coriander leaf - from 1 small bunch
  9. Curry leaf - handful
  10. Shredded coconut - handful
  11. Cashew nut - 5 count
  12. Cinnamon stick - 1 inch
  13. Clove - 3
  14. Cardamom - 3
  15. Fennel seed - 1 teaspoon (tsp.)
  16. Ginger - 2 inch
  17. Garlic - 15 clove
  18. Chili powder - 1 teaspoon (tsp.)
  19. Turmeric powder - 1 teaspoon (tsp.)
  20. Peanut oil - 150 milliliter
  21. Salt - as needed

PREPARATION:

  1. Grind coconut, shallot (sambar onion), 3 green chili, cashew nuts, handful of mint leaves, handful of coriander leaves, cinnamon stick, clove, fennel seeds, cardamom into thick fine paste by adding little water as possible.
  2. Wash the rice and soak in water for at least 30 min. Drain water and keep it aside.
  3. Heat oil 100 milliliter sesame oil in a pressure cooker. Now add onion and sauté until they become translucent.
  4. Now add rest of the green chili, tomato, curry leaves, rest of mint leaves, rest of coriander leaves and sauté until tomato become mushy.
  5. Now add the ground coconut paste and sauté. once the raw smell is gone add chicken pieces, salt, turmeric powder, chili powder and sauté well.
  6. Now add 200 milliliter of water and bring to boil. Once it starts to boil place the pressure cooker lid, place the whistle and cook for 5 whistle. and remove from heat NOTE: nattu kozi will take longer to cook than regular boiler chicken.
  7. Once the pressure is gone. Now add water to rice ratio as 1 : 1.5 and place in the heat and bring to boil. NOTE: count for liquid if present in the cooker at that time.
  8. Now add rest of the oil and pressure cook for 2 whistle only and remove from heat and wait for the pressure to be gone.
  9. Remove the lid and mix gentle without breaking the rice and serve.

NOTES:

  1. 1 kilo rice uncooked = 5 cups uncooked. so you have to add about 7.5 cups of water.
